Transaction 128d2e32ac93e594340289fb016c6f05ccb611f3fca637f0c3cd0aa38bcd6f69

1 Input
1 Outputs
  • 128d2e32ac93e594340289fb016c6f05ccb611f3fca637f0c3cd0aa38bcd6f69:0
  • value  2460117
    address  12bzHvjmauaPn1Sef26vW7Lqib1PeJHWXe